Judge Sides With Union in Chicago Teacher Layoffs
Judge Sides With Union in Chicago Teacher Layoffs
By Azam Ahmed, Chicago Tribune (MCT)

In a blow to the Chicago Public Schools, a federal judge on Monday sided with the Chicago Teachers Union by ruling that last summer's layoffs of more than 700 tenured teachers was handled improperly.

The decision by U.S. District Judge David Coar follows a months-long battle between the union and district officials over the termination of teachers who are typically protected by their union contract.

Nearly 1,300 teachers—more than 60 percent of them tenured—were laid off before school started this year in light of what the district said was a gaping budget hole.
